Robin Pingeton: A Career Retrospective

In 2010, the most popular movie was “Toy Story 3,” the most popular album was Ke$ha’s “Tik Tok,” the president was Barack Obama, Brady Cook was nine years old and Robin Pingeton was hired as Missouri women’s basketball coach.

15 years later, the Pingeton era is over, as MU athletic director Laird Veatch announced she would step down as head coach after the end of the season.

While the search for the fifth head coach in program history is ongoing, Rock M Nation takes a look at Pingeton’s long career with the Tigers.
